如何充分利用Linux服务器空闲时间?
在今天的计算机技术中,Linux服务器已经成为了一个不可或缺的存在。然而,在使用Linux服务器的过程中,我们常常遇到服务器空闲时间太多的情况,而不知如何去充分利用这些空闲时间。本文将从四个方面详细阐述如何充分利用Linux服务器的空闲时间。
1、配置计划任务
计划任务是Linux服务器中非常常用的一种管理工具。它可以使得需要定时执行的任务在指定的时间自动执行,而不需要人为干预。通过配置计划任务,我们可以让Linux服务器在空闲时间内执行一些重复性较高的任务,例如自动备份数据、定时清理系统日志等。这些任务可以很好地利用服务器的空闲时间,同时也可以提高服务器的自动化程度和效率。指定计划任务的方式也非常简单,我们只需要使用Linux服务器自带的crontab工具,创建一个cron表达式,指定要执行的命令即可。例如,我们可以在晚上的时候执行一次系统备份,并把备份好的数据上传到远程服务器上,实现系统备份和数据共享的目的。
除此之外,我们还可以设置计划任务来定时清理无用的日志和临时文件等,这也是非常常见的服务器管理方法。
2、开启虚拟化技术
虚拟化技术是目前服务器管理的一个非常重要的发展方向。通过虚拟化技术,我们可以在同一个物理服务器上运行多个虚拟服务器,并在空闲时间自动调整各个虚拟服务器的资源分配,实现对服务器资源的充分利用。对于Linux服务器来说,虚拟化技术的实现相对比较容易。我们可以使用开源的虚拟化软件,例如VirtualBox、KVM等,创建多个虚拟机,并将它们部署到同一个Linux服务器上。在服务器空闲的时候,我们可以开启所有的虚拟服务器,充分利用服务器资源。
虚拟化技术还可以帮助我们快速恢复操作系统,通过虚拟化技术可以实现系统的快速备份和还原,进一步提高服务器的可靠性和稳定性。
3、搭建云计算平台
云计算是一种新型的计算技术,通过将计算资源集中在云端,以服务的形式向用户提供计算、存储、网络等服务。一个良好的云计算平台可以在服务器空闲时间中充分利用计算资源,提高服务器资源利用率。对于Linux服务器来说,搭建云计算平台相对比较简单。我们可以使用开源云计算软件,例如OpenStack、OpenNebula等,在Linux服务器上部署云计算平台,快速创建虚拟机、进行数据备份和还原、高效运行云应用等。在服务器空闲时间内,我们可以使用这种方式来提高服务器资源利用效率和服务器的自动化程度。
4、搭建容器化平台
容器化技术是目前最为流行的技术之一。通过容器化技术,我们可以将应用程序、开发环境等打包成为一个独立的容器,并在多个服务器上运行这些容器。容器化技术可以提高服务器资源利用效率,降低服务器资源的浪费。对于Linux服务器来说,搭建容器化平台也是非常简单的。我们可以使用Docker、Kubernetes等开源软件,将应用程序和开发环境容器化,并在多个服务器上运行这些容器。在服务器空闲时间内,我们可以开启更多的容器,从而充分利用服务器资源。
综上所述,通过计划任务、虚拟化技术、云计算平台和容器化技术这四种方法,我们可以充分利用Linux服务器的空闲时间,提高服务器资源的利用效率和自动化程度。同时,这些方法也可以帮助我们降低服务器成本,提高服务器的可靠性和稳定性。
因此,在今后的服务器管理中,我们应该学会利用这些方法来更好地管理Linux服务器,提高我们的工作效率和效益。
本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!